Resumen:
To characterize the reproductive biology of Scinax acuminatus and contributeto the natural history of this species, the morphology of the reproductive system ofmales and females was analyzed at anatomical, histological and immunohistochemicallevels. The individuals were collected fortnightly between August and December(2016) and January to December (2018). The anatomy of the reproductive system wasanalyzed in a stereoscopic microscope, and histological preparations staining withhematoxylin-eosin and Masson?s trichromic, PAS and Coomassie Blue was performedas well. To characterize the meiotic-active cells in the testes, immunostaining with thePCNA proliferation protein was performed. There were found females with ovaries withoocytes in different stages of maturity and post-ovulatory females. Males presentedcontinuous spermatogenesis, which could be confirmed by the immunostaining of PCNAin spermatogonia during the cycle. The results of this work serve as a basis for thecharacterization of the reproductive cycle in S. acuminatus and provide backgroundinformation on the analysis of spermatogenic activity by IHQ from the study of theimmunodetection of the PCNA cell proliferation protein. Future studies will focus on theevaluation of cell death processes during the reproductive cycle in the studied speciesto compare with those obtained in terms of cell proliferation.
